This week, the FDA, in partnership with its agency of record, FCB New York, is embarking on a new campaign to show how withdrawal from nicotine in cigarettes can lead to symptoms of anxiety, feeling angry or irritable, insomnia, excessive worrying, restlessness, and fatigue—key factors that negatively impact mental health among teens.
